Medvedev signed a decree on expanding the Taman seaport

Photo: TASS Prime Minister Dmitry Medvedev signed a decree on the expansion of the sea port of Taman in the Krasnodar region, aimed at implementation of new investment projects and infrastructure development. The document was published on the website of the Cabinet. “The port plans construction of a terminal for bulk cargo with a capacity of 35 million tons per year; the grain terminal, LLC “Mriya Taman”; terminal ZAO “Tamanneftegas” (mooring complex of liquefied hydrocarbon gases and technological overpass); terminal ZAO “Tamanneftegas” (transshipment of oversized and heavy cargo). The signed Directive establishes a category of lands and permitted use created artificial land plots”, – stated in the explanatory note to the document. It is noted that the project is implemented fully at the expense of the investor – of the holding JSC “OTEKO”. Died, Russia’s permanent representative to the UN Vitaly Churkin

Vitaly Corkindale: media called the cause of death Churkin Permanent representative of Russia to the UN Vitaly Churkin has died in new York at the age of 64 years. This February 20 reported the Russian foreign Ministry. “The Russian foreign Ministry with a deep regret informs that on 20 February, the day before your 65th birthday, in new York, died suddenly permanent representative of the Russian Federation to the UN Vitaly Churkin, — said in a statement. — An outstanding Russian diplomat died in working post. We Express to the families and friends of Vitaly Ivanovich Churkin deep condolences.” Vitaly Churkin joined the diplomatic service in 1974 and in 1992 became Deputy Minister of foreign Affairs of Russia. From 1994 to 1998 he was Ambassador of Russia to Belgium, permanent representative to NATO. He subsequently held the post of Ambassador to Canada, Ambassador for special assignments. Trump has appointed General McMaster as his adviser on national security

Herbert Raymond McMaster US President, Donald trump declared that the post of national security adviser is General Herbert Raymond McMaster. About it reports Reuters. Prior to this, McMaster has served in various command positions in the army of the United States, participated in operations in Afghanistan and Iraq. In turn, the retired General Keith Kellogg, who since the departure of Michael Flynn temporarily fulfilled duties of the adviser, will manage the office of the Council of national security of the United States. Flynn resigned after the publication in the Washington Post, where he provided details of his conversation with the Russian Ambassador to the U.S. Sergei Kislyak. The edition, in particular, wrote that in conversation it was about anti-Russian sanctions. After that, Flynn has submitted his resignation, indicating that it is fully informed Vice-President Mike Pence and other members of the White house about his conversations with Kislyak.
